Probabilistic damage detection and identification of coupled structural parameters using Bayesian model updating with added mass

نویسندگان

چکیده

Damage detection inevitably involves uncertainties originated from measurement noise and modeling error. It may cause incorrect damage results if not appropriately treating uncertainties.
